RELATEED CONSULTING
相关咨询
选择下列产品马上在线沟通
服务时间:8:30-17:00
你可能遇到了下面的问题
关闭右侧工具栏

新闻中心

这里有您想知道的互联网营销解决方案
AngularJS怎么实现tab选项卡

这篇文章主要介绍了AngularJS怎么实现tab选项卡,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。

在正阳等地区,都构建了全面的区域性战略布局,加强发展的系统性、市场前瞻性、产品创新能力,以专注、极致的服务理念,为客户提供成都网站设计、成都网站建设 网站设计制作按需定制制作,公司网站建设,企业网站建设,成都品牌网站建设,成都全网营销,成都外贸网站建设公司,正阳网站建设费用合理。

JS是什么

JS是JavaScript的简称,它是一种直译式的脚本语言,其解释器被称为JavaScript引擎,是浏览器的一部分,主要用于web的开发,可以给网站添加各种各样的动态效果,让网页更加美观。

具体如下:

一、代码实现



  
    
    
    
    
  
  
    
      
        许嵩
        周杰伦
        林俊杰
        陈奕迅
      
      
        断桥残雪、千百度、幻听、想象之中
        红尘客栈、牛仔很忙、给我一首歌的时间、听妈妈的话
        被风吹过的夏天、江南、一千年以后
        十年、K歌之王、浮夸
      
    
          var app=angular.module('app',[]);     app.controller('tabcontroller',function($scope){       var vm=$scope.vm;     });   

二、效果预览

AngularJS怎么实现tab选项卡

三、实现原理

选项卡的内容是显示还是隐藏是由activeTab的值决定的,而这个值是通过选项卡上面的ng-click指令设置的,当对应选项卡的内容显示的时候,给点击的按钮添加样式,这样做虽然也能实现选项卡的内容,但是这样做的的弊端是,选项卡的内容是固定的,不好去改变,所以接下来我们将上面的代码改成下面这种形式

四、改版



  
    
    
    
    
  
  
    
      
        {{item.list}}
      
      
        {{item.con}}
      
    
          var app=angular.module('app',[]);     app.controller('tabcontroller',function($scope){       $scope.vm=[         {"list":"许嵩","con":"断桥残雪、千百度、幻听、想象之中"},         {"list":"周杰伦","con":"红尘客栈、牛仔很忙、给我一首歌的时间、听妈妈的话"},         {"list":"林俊杰","con":"被风吹过的夏天、江南、一千年以后"},         {"list":"陈奕迅","con":"十年、K歌之王、浮夸"}       ];       var selected=$scope.selected;       $scope.show=function(index){         $scope.selected=index;       };     });   

说明:vm这个数组里面是我们自己定义的一些假数据(这个数据实际上是可以从后台获取的),然后我们通过ng-repeat指令循环遍历出vm里面的数据,插入到页面中,$index是每个内容对象的索引值

感谢你能够认真阅读完这篇文章,希望小编分享的“AngularJS怎么实现tab选项卡”这篇文章对大家有帮助,同时也希望大家多多支持创新互联,关注创新互联行业资讯频道,更多相关知识等着你来学习!


当前标题:AngularJS怎么实现tab选项卡
标题网址:http://lswzjz.com/article/gesepp.html